Season 2024/25
==Season 2024/25==
* <span style="background-color:aqua;">'''2025-02-03 to 2025-02-04/ 2 days / Packrafting/ SOBO/ RP / Tomáš&Natalie&Thijmen'''</span>
 
We all met at camp at km 7.4 - it is paid, 10000 ARG for three people, very basic, only cold water and toilets available. The next day we got up early, started after dawn at 7:00 and paddled through the lake Ridadavia in 4 hours. In the beginning and middle we had some tailwind and waves (30 cm max), then it got better. By 11, we were on the other side, where there is indeed a rope. We are not sure if the sign that you are not supposed to cross without a guide applies only to fishers. Probably not, but seeing two fisher boats cross without paying attention to us, we went for it. The river Calihuel is class I, the rapid waypoints are not demanding at all, it took us maybe two hours to get to Lago Verde, but the river flows. We paddled the lake in 30 minutes. The shop at 31.6 with an extremely limited offer is misplaced, it is at the bridge at the end of Lago Verde: -42.72669, -71.74049 in a building with functioning toilets (yay!). The bridge is overrun with people. Rio Arrayanes does not flow that much, expect to paddle. Having read the reports about vigilant guardaparques, we wanted to sleep in an official campsite. Probably we would have gotten away with wild-camping if we managed to hide in the vegetation though. We camped at camping Cuma Hue here: -42.77572, -71.73476, 15mil pp. It has 9 places for tents, but not all were taken. Showers have lukewarm water, and toilets function (well, you pay for it, though I would not be sure in Argentina). Coming from the water, nobody checks you or sees you, we think we would have gotten away without paying, it was quite a struggle to find a person to pay at the hospidaje uproad. 29 km paddled in a day.
 
The next day we crossed waveless lake Futalaufquen to Lago Krugger. Only in the strait between the two lakes you get some stream helping you, as lago Krugger is not 2 m higher as OSM elevation data show. We were denied to go for 25P, see our entry there for details.
 
Thijmen notes:
 
* The camp site at lago Puelo was paid but cheap : 10.000 for 3 people.
* The river had some nice little rapids. Just watch out for the wood in the water and above the water. Great beautiful float !
* We were with 3 so we camped at an official camping, which was expensive (15.000) and barely had facilities (no electricity, internet or hot showers). Because I read on the Wikiloc other people got caught by the guards. If you are on your one I would wildcamp and be very stealthy. Don't show your boat or tent in sight from the lake.
* Lake futalaufquen and Lago Krugger are nice paddle.
* We went trough Lago Kruger in order to do the 25P. However when we wanted to start on the trail to trail next to Rio Frey we passed the guards and they did not let us trough and we had to show our pasport. So we returned hiking via option 1 to via futalaufquen.
* Option 1 is steep but very well maintained and easy trail.
* So if you wanne do #25P you have to sneak past the park guards by putting your packraft to shore more at the beginning of Rio Frey and sneak in the trail from there.
